Abstract
A source-matching service may gather information from one or more interest resources, then process the information to generate a set of keywords corresponding to an item or type of item in which users of a network-based service may be interested. Optionally, the source-matching service may identify a source to provide an item described by the interest keywords through the network-based service, and offer the source the opportunity to provide the item described by the interest keywords through the network-based service.
